HP LaserJet Pro Devices Vulnerable to XSS Attack via Web Management Interface
CVE-2024-2301
7.6HIGH
Summary
Certain HP LaserJet Pro devices are at risk of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) attacks through their web management interfaces. This vulnerability allows an attacker to inject malicious scripts into web pages viewed by users. An unauthenticated attacker could exploit this issue, potentially leading to unauthorized actions being performed on behalf of unsuspecting users. It is crucial for administrators to ensure their devices are updated and appropriately secured to mitigate this risk.
